首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无线网更改ip有域名

基础概念

无线网更改IP通常指的是修改无线网络设备的IP地址,这可能涉及到路由器、交换机或其他网络设备的配置。而域名则是互联网上用于标识和定位网站的字符串,它与IP地址之间存在映射关系,通过DNS(域名系统)进行解析。

相关优势

  1. 灵活性:更改IP地址可以提供更大的灵活性,特别是在需要避免IP地址冲突、优化网络性能或进行安全配置时。
  2. 安全性:通过更改IP地址,可以隐藏真实的网络位置,增加网络的安全性。
  3. 管理便利:对于大型网络,动态分配IP地址可以简化网络管理。

类型

  • 静态IP:手动配置的固定IP地址,通常用于服务器等需要稳定访问的设备。
  • 动态IP:由DHCP服务器自动分配的IP地址,适用于大多数客户端设备。

应用场景

  • 家庭网络:更改家庭无线路由器的IP地址,以避免与邻居的网络冲突。
  • 企业网络:在企业内部网络中,更改服务器或特定设备的IP地址,以优化网络性能或增强安全性。
  • 云服务:在云环境中,更改虚拟机的IP地址,以便更好地管理和控制网络流量。

遇到的问题及原因

问题1:更改IP后无法访问域名

原因

  1. DNS缓存未刷新:更改IP后,DNS服务器可能仍然缓存旧的IP地址。
  2. DNS配置错误:DNS服务器上的域名解析记录可能未正确更新。
  3. 网络配置错误:路由器或其他网络设备的配置可能未正确应用。

解决方法

  1. 清除DNS缓存:可以在命令行中使用ipconfig /flushdns(Windows)或sudo systemd-resolve --flush-caches(Linux)命令清除DNS缓存。
  2. 检查DNS配置:确保DNS服务器上的域名解析记录已正确更新。
  3. 检查网络配置:验证路由器或其他网络设备的配置是否已正确应用。

问题2:更改IP后域名解析失败

原因

  1. DNS服务器故障:DNS服务器可能发生故障,导致无法解析域名。
  2. 网络连接问题:网络连接可能存在问题,导致无法访问DNS服务器。
  3. 域名配置错误:域名配置可能未正确设置,导致无法解析。

解决方法

  1. 检查DNS服务器状态:确保DNS服务器正常运行。
  2. 检查网络连接:验证网络连接是否正常,可以尝试ping DNS服务器的IP地址。
  3. 检查域名配置:确保域名配置已正确设置,并与DNS服务器上的记录一致。

示例代码

以下是一个简单的Python脚本,用于检查域名的解析情况:

代码语言:txt
复制
import socket

def check_domain_resolution(domain):
    try:
        ip_address = socket.gethostbyname(domain)
        print(f"Domain {domain} resolves to IP address: {ip_address}")
    except socket.gaierror as e:
        print(f"Failed to resolve domain {domain}: {e}")

# 示例使用
check_domain_resolution("example.com")

参考链接

请注意,以上内容仅供参考,具体问题可能需要根据实际情况进行排查和解决。如果需要更详细的帮助,建议咨询专业的网络技术人员或参考相关的技术文档。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券